{"id":12465,"date":"2022-08-27T00:00:00","date_gmt":"2022-08-26T22:00:00","guid":{"rendered":"https:\/\/ungeracademy.com\/it\/blog\/trading-algoritmico-cosa-e-come-funziona"},"modified":"2022-08-27T00:00:00","modified_gmt":"2022-08-26T22:00:00","slug":"trading-algoritmico-cosa-e-come-funziona","status":"publish","type":"post","link":"https:\/\/ungeracademy.com\/it\/posts\/trading-algoritmico-cosa-e-come-funziona","title":{"rendered":"Trading algoritmico: cos\u2019\u00e8 e come funziona?"},"content":{"rendered":"
Sempre pi\u00f9 trader stanno abbandonando l\u2019operativit\u00e0 discrezionale a favore di quella algoritmica. Ma perch\u00e9 il trading algoritmico \u00e8 cos\u00ec vantaggioso?\u00a0 In questa guida cercheremo di fornirti una panoramica sintetica sulle caratteristiche, sul funzionamento e sui vantaggi principali dell\u2019approccio algoritmico. In pi\u00f9, ti mostreremo come partire da zero, creando un sistema molto semplice per inviare degli ordini in maniera automatica sul Mini S&P500.<\/em><\/p>\n Il trading algoritmico, o semplicemente \u201calgo trading\u201d, \u00e8 una tipologia di trading in cui, come suggerisce il nome, le istruzioni della strategia vengono codificate tramite un algoritmo. Si tratta di un tipo di trading che viene anche definito \u201cquantitativo\u201d o \u201csistematico\u201d poich\u00e9 l\u2019esecuzione degli ordini avviene in maniera automatica tramite sistemi<\/em> e codici computerizzati (i cosiddetti \u201ctrading system<\/strong>\u201d).<\/p>\n In questo approccio, l\u2019operativit\u00e0 quotidiana \u00e8 delegata quasi interamente alla macchina che esegue le istruzioni codificate dal trader.<\/strong><\/p>\n Possiamo immaginare un trader sistematico come un comandante che imposta e supervisiona un aereo su cui ha inserito il pilota automatico. Ovviamente, le conoscenze e competenze del comandante sono fondamentali per impostare correttamente la rotta e l\u2019andamento dell\u2019aereo, cos\u00ec come \u00e8 fondamentale che un trader abbia la formazione giusta per sviluppare e gestire correttamente i propri trading system.<\/p>\n Il trading algoritmico si basa su codici e sistemi chiamati \u201ctrading system\u201d.<\/strong><\/p>\n Un trading system \u00e8 un insieme di regole che stabiliscono quando<\/em> e quali<\/em> ordini mandare a mercato per aprire o chiudere una posizione<\/strong> sulla base di precisi parametri (ad esempio i pattern di prezzo) preimpostati dal trader.<\/p>\n Nel momento in cui le condizioni specifiche di un mercato soddisfano i criteri predefiniti, gli algoritmi eseguono automaticamente l\u2019ordine di acquisto\/vendita<\/strong> senza che il trader debba stare H24 davanti allo schermo.<\/p>\n Come \u00e8 facile intuire, ci\u00f2 aumenta notevolmente la possibilit\u00e0 di operare su uno svariato numero di mercati, anche contemporaneamente, e riduce, al contempo la stanchezza, lo stress e l\u2019errore umano.<\/p>\n Il trading algoritmico consente infatti di aumentare significativamente la diversificazione del proprio portafoglio<\/strong>, cosa molto pi\u00f9 complessa per un trader discrezionale.<\/p>\n Ovviamente, in questo approccio la scelta del software \u00e8 essenziale per la buona riuscita della propria strategia di trading. Se non sai come fare, qui puoi capire come scegliere e come installare da zero il software<\/u><\/a> pi\u00f9 adatto a te.<\/p>\n Diversamente dal trading discrezionale, quello algoritmico offre numerosi vantaggi, tra cui:<\/p>\n 1. Libera il trader dalla schiavit\u00f9 del monitor<\/strong>: un trader discrezionale \u00e8 costretto a stare ore davanti ad un monitor, il che comporta fatica fisica e mentale. Nel trading algoritmico, invece, la parte operativa \u00e8 demandata alla macchina.<\/p>\n<\/li>\n 2. Riduce l\u2019errore umano<\/strong>: stress, stanchezza e distrazione possono portare il trader discrezionale a commettere errori spesso anche gravi. L\u2019operativit\u00e0 algoritmica, invece, se eseguita in modo corretto riduce notevolmente le possibilit\u00e0 di errore e consente un migliore money <\/strong>e risk management<\/strong>.<\/p>\n<\/li>\n 3. Ha un minor impatto emotivo: <\/strong>il trader discrezionale agisce e reagisce<\/em> in tempo reale agli stimoli del mercato, prendendo decisioni istintive, spesso dettate dalla paura o dall\u2019avidit\u00e0. Al contrario, nell\u2019operativit\u00e0 algoritmica tutto viene pianificato a priori, il che consente una migliore esecuzione del piano di trading.<\/p>\n<\/li>\n 4. \u00c8 oggettivo, quantificabile e codificabile<\/strong>: l\u2019operativit\u00e0 discrezionale si basa sull\u2019istinto del singolo trader, dunque non pu\u00f2 essere tradotta in regole. Al contrario, l\u2019operativit\u00e0 algoritmica \u00e8 oggettiva, quantificabile e codificabile in una serie di ordini eseguibili dalla macchina.<\/p>\n<\/li>\n 5. \u00c8 estendibile<\/strong>: il trading algoritmico si basa su un metodo scientifico che pu\u00f2 essere applicato a mercati e timeframe diversi.<\/p>\n<\/li>\n 6. \u00c8 trasmissibile<\/strong>: mentre il trading discrezionale si basa sull\u2019intuito e sul talento personale del singolo trader (doti che non possono essere \u201ctrasferite\u201d), l\u2019approccio algoritmico si basa su un metodo che pu\u00f2 essere insegnato, trasmesso e appreso.<\/p>\n<\/li>\n 7. \u00c8 testabile<\/strong>: le strategie sistematiche si basano su un metodo che pu\u00f2 essere testato e verificato, mentre l\u2019operativit\u00e0 discrezionale non pu\u00f2 essere testata.<\/p>\n<\/li>\n<\/ol>\n Le principali famiglie di trading system includono:<\/p>\n Trend following<\/strong>: questa tipologia di sistemi sfrutta la forza \/debolezza di un mercato e consiste nel cavalcare un trend in atto, come un surfista fa con un\u2019onda. Nel trend following si segue la direzione che il mercato ha iniziato a prendere, rialzista o ribassista che sia, e si cerca di sfruttare il pi\u00f9 possibile il movimento del mercato.<\/p>\n<\/li>\n Controtrend \/ Reversal<\/strong>: in questi sistemi si entra contro la direzione del mercato, ipotizzando un\u2019inversione del trend.<\/p>\n<\/li>\n Bias<\/strong>: sistemi che si basano su statistiche e dati storici e sfruttano determinati comportamenti ripetitivi di uno strumento finanziario. I sistemi bias sono particolarmente adatti a mercati come quello delle commodity che risentono molto della stagionalit\u00e0.<\/p>\n<\/li>\n Swing Trading<\/strong>: in questo tipo di sistemi si cerca di sfruttare i movimenti \u201celastici\u201d del mercato. Individuato un determinato movimento, cio\u00e8, si ipotizza uno spostamento (in termini tecnici un \u201cpullback\u201d) e poi un ritorno verso la direzione iniziale. Questo tipo di sistemi si applica molto bene a mercati estremamente volatili.<\/p>\n<\/li>\n<\/ul>\n Esistono diverse piattaforme per creare trading system, ognuna con aspetti e funzionalit\u00e0 diverse. La scelta, dunque, dipende dagli obiettivi, dalle caratteristiche e dalle esigenze di ogni singolo trader.<\/p>\n Ecco le principali:<\/strong><\/p>\n MultiCharts<\/u><\/strong><\/a>: \u00e8 facile da programmare, ottimo nella gestione real time e consente di scegliere diversi broker.<\/p>\n<\/li>\n TradeStation<\/u><\/strong><\/a>: ha un ampio storico con dati propri, \u00e8 facile da programmare e ha una community ampia. Non copre, per\u00f2, tutti i mercati.<\/p>\n<\/li>\nCos\u2019\u00e8 il trading algoritmico<\/h2>\n
Come funziona il trading algoritmico<\/h2>\n
Perch\u00e9 fare trading algoritmico: 7 vantaggi rispetto all\u2019operativit\u00e0 discrezionale<\/h2>\n
\n
Tipologie principali di trading system<\/h2>\n
\n
Quali Piattaforme usare per fare trading algoritmico?<\/h2>\n
\n